Teen Torture, Inc.

10:00 PM to 11:00 PM
Tuesday 11 November
+

The Kids on the Inside

Season 1 Episode 3

Naomi Wood dies at a teen facility in Florida. Bethel and Agape students confront their abusers and legislation passes to reform the industry

Teen Torture, Inc. airs on Quest Red at 10:00 PM, Tuesday 11 November. (New.)
Topics
Education ➝ Science ➝ Factual Topics
Factual Crime